Cape Verde Soccer

Cape Verde arrives with an underdog edge and a style that has grown sharper with every major tournament cycle. The Cape Verde soccer team, known as the Blue Sharks, has built its modern reputation on disciplined defending, quick breaks, and dangerous set pieces that keep matches within reach. Cape Verde reached the Africa Cup of Nations quarterfinals in both 2013 and 2023, with winger Ryan Mendes often sparking the attack when the tempo changes. Under longtime coach Bubista, this group has made a habit of staying organized, then striking when opponents switch off.
